OdenOden is a traditional Japanese snack made with various ingredients such as fish balls, meatballs, tofu, and more, all simmered in a specially prepared broth. The ingredients are skewered on bamboo sticks and slowly cooked in the broth until they absorb the rich flavors, resulting in a delicious and savory taste.
Steamed Egg Custard with TeaChawanmushi is a steamed dish primarily made with eggs, shrimp, chicken, and fish. The ingredients are diced and mixed with egg liquid, then combined with an appropriate amount of water or dashi broth. After filtering, the mixture is poured into bowls and steamed over water. The finished dish has a delicate, smooth texture with rich layers of flavor.

Japanese SukiyakiJapanese sukiyaki, primarily made with thin slices of beef, tofu, and vegetables. The method involves adding a special sauce to a shallow pot, cooking the ingredients one by one, and finally enjoying them by dipping into raw egg yolk.
Japanese-style Hamburg SteakJapanese hamburger patty is mainly made from ground beef or pork, mixed with onions, garlic, eggs, and seasonings, then shaped into patties and pan-fried. It is usually served with Japanese sauce or ketchup, and sometimes placed in a bun as bento or fast food.
Japanese Hamburg Steak RiceJapanese-style hamburger steak rice is a dish that combines elements of Japanese cuisine and Western dishes. The main ingredients include tender pork patties, rich sauce, and steaming hot rice. The preparation involves frying the pork patties until golden and crispy, then serving them with a specially made Japanese-style sauce, all enjoyed together with rice.
Teriyaki Chicken Rice BowlTeriyaki chicken rice is made with chicken cutlets as the main ingredient, cooked with a specially prepared teriyaki sauce. The chicken cutlets are first pan-fried until golden brown, then coated with a thickened sauce made by simmering soy sauce, sugar, and mirin until it becomes syrupy, allowing the chicken to fully absorb the rich aroma of the sauce.
